Abstract

This paper aims to present the logistics collaboration management model and performance improvement of orchid flower firms in logistics activities for growers and exporters. The collaboration results improving cost, time and reliability to all parties in the chain. The collaboration management model becomes firms’ management tools for competitive advantage among rivals in the industry. The logistics performance indicator model uses to measure the activities between pre and post collaboration. The research contributes the uniqueness logistics collaborative management model which value to orchid industry in Thailand. The orchid flower grower and exporter may use this model as their management tool which aims in competitive advantage.
